组合数

来源:互联网 发布:mac最新系统怎么升级 编辑:程序博客网 时间:2024/05/01 07:43
/*   * 程序的版权和版本声明部分   * Copyright (c)2012, 烟台大学计算机学院学生   * All rightsreserved.   * 文件名称: fun.cpp                              * 作    者: 徐汉玉                              * 完成日期:2012  年11  月15   日   * 版本号: v1.0         * 对任务及求解方法的描述部分   * 输入描述:   * 问题描述:   * 程序输出:   */  #include<iostream>using namespace std;int main(){long factor(int n);int m,n,k;cout<<"请输入m,n"<<endl;    cin>>m>>n;if(m<n)cout<<"哥们错了"<<endl;else{    k=factor(m)/(factor(n)*factor(m-n));    cout<<"组合数"<<k<<endl;}}long factor(int n){     if(n==1||n==0) return 1; else return n*factor(n-1);}


运行结果:

原创粉丝点击